Understanding Shipping Containers
Shipping containers can be found in different sizes and types, developed to fulfill different requirements. Here are the most common types you will find in the market:
Container TypeDescriptionDimensions (L x W x H)Standard DryThe most common type for general cargo.20' x 8' x 8.5'High Cube DryTaller than basic containers for more area.40' x 8' x 9.5'RefrigeratedInsulated containers with refrigeration units for perishable products.40' x 8' x 9.5'Open TopGeared up with a detachable tarpaulin cover for extra-large Cargo Storage Containers.20' x 8' x 8.5'Flat RackFlat platform, frequently used for heavy or large loads.40' x 8' x 2.5'ISO TankCylindrical tanks designed for transferring liquids.20' x 8' x 8.5'Common Uses for Shipping Containers
Shipping containers have discovered a large array of applications, including but not restricted to:
Storage Solutions: Businesses and people utilize shipping containers for storing items, devices, or tools.
Residential Homes: Creative designers and homeowners are repurposing shipping containers into modern, trendy homes.
Mobile Offices: Businesses frequently convert containers into portable workplace, providing a practical solution for construction websites and remote work places.
Retail Spaces: Many startups and developed brands have turned to shipping containers as pop-up retail shops, offering an unique shopping experience.
Workshops and Studios: Artists and craftsmen have found shipping containers best for setting up workshops, studios, or hobby areas.
What to Consider When Buying a Shipping Container
When considering acquiring a shipping container, purchasers need to examine a number of factors:
1. Purpose of Use
Different usages require various types of containers. Examine what you require the container for, whether it's for storage, living space, or another function.
2. New vs. Used Containers
New Containers: These containers remain in pristine condition and devoid of rust or damages. They are generally more expensive but can serve longer without repairs.
Used Containers: Often more cost effective, used containers might reveal signs of wear and tear, which could affect their functionality. It's important to check them for structural stability.
3. Container Size
Containers generally can be found in 20-foot and 40-foot lengths, but other sizes exist. Select a size that satisfies your capability needs without excess space.
4. Delivery Logistics
Think about how you will transport the container to your place. Some providers use delivery services, while others may need you to pick it up.
5. Local Regulations
Before purchasing a container, it's vital to check local zoning laws and building codes, especially if you prepare to convert it for living or business usage.
6. Cost
Prices for shipping containers can differ based upon size, condition, and place. Here's a general cost variety based on the type of container:

2. Just how much does a shipping container weigh?
The weight of a container varies based on size and type, however a basic 20-foot dry container normally weighs around 4,800 pounds (2,200 kg), while a 40-foot container can weigh around 8,000 pounds (3,600 kg).
3. For how long do shipping containers last?
With correct maintenance, Modified Shipping Containers containers can last for 25 years or more. Factors that impact longevity include exposure to weather, quality of materials, and how they are used.

5. Can I customize a shipping container?
Yes, lots of people modify shipping containers for special usages. Modifications might consist of adding windows, doors, insulation, and electric circuitry, to name a few changes.
